Gospel Musical March 20, 2010 at 6:30 pm Bethel United (Pentecostal Church), Tan Bank.

 

This project was designed by children and young people from within the Borough of Telford and Wrekin.

Each song was represented how they would have felt if they were captured during the time people were taken from Africa to America and the Caribbean.

 

It is very emotional and entertaining, as they tell the story of their high and low points and confusion by not understanding each other's language, they did not know what to expect at the end of their journey.
